๐ข Terminal Information
Ngala Airfield (NGL) is a private regional facility serving the Ngala Private Game Reserve in the Limpopo province of South Africa, situated on the western boundary of the Kruger National Park. The terminal is a simple and elegant open-air structure that primarily handles domestic charter flights operated by Federal Air, connecting the reserve with major hubs like Johannesburg and Kruger Mpumalanga International. it is a critical gateway for tourists seeking a luxury safari experience in one of South Africa's premier wildlife areas.
Inside the terminal, facilities are basic but high-quality, featuring a comfortable waiting area and administrative support for safari-bound travelers. There are no commercial shops or dining options at the airfield, as most guests are met by their lodge rangers upon arrival and provided with refreshments. The facility plays a vital role in the regional tourism economy, supporting the local safari lodges and ensuring a seamless and exclusive entry point for international and domestic visitors.
Ground transportation from the airfield to the various Ngala safari lodges is almost exclusively via open-top safari vehicles provided by the reserve. The airfield's location in the heart of the bushveld offers travelers spectacular views of the savannah and the diverse wildlife of the Timbavati region during arrival and departure. It remains a critical infrastructure point for the connectivity and exclusivity of the Ngala community, ensuring that this remote and wildlife-rich area remains accessible by air for a world-class safari experience.

๐ข Terminal Information
Malamala Airport (AAM) is an exclusive, private airfield located within the world-renowned MalaMala Game Reserve in South Africa's Mpumalanga province. The "terminal" experience is unlike any commercial airport; it is an intimate and seamless part of the luxury safari journey. Upon landing, guests are personally greeted by their safari ranger at the side of the aircraft. There is no terminal building in the traditional sense, but rather a charming, rustic reception area that blends into the bushveld, where welcome drinks are served before guests are whisked away on their first game drive.
The entire process is designed for privacy, comfort, and efficiency, eliminating queues and formal procedures. Luggage is handled by the lodge staff and transferred directly to guests' suites. The airstrip itself is well-maintained to accommodate the specialized turboprop aircraft used for the shuttle services, such as those operated by Federal Air. The focus is not on passenger volume but on providing a discreet and highly personalized welcome to one of Africa's most iconic private game reserves.
All amenities and facilities are provided at the luxurious MalaMala safari camps, not at the airstrip. The airfield serves purely as a point of arrival and departure. This unique setup ensures that from the moment they step off the plane, guests are immersed in the sights and sounds of the African bush, with the transfer from the airstrip to the lodge often turning into an impromptu game-viewing opportunity.
๐ Connection Tips
Connecting to and from Malamala Airport is a highly organized and exclusive service, primarily facilitated by Federal Air's daily shuttle flights from O.R. Tambo International Airport (JNB) in Johannesburg. These flights are specifically for guests of MalaMala and other nearby luxury lodges. When booking your international flights into Johannesburg, it is crucial to allow sufficient time for the connection. The recommended minimum connection time is 2 hours for domestic arrivals at JNB and 3 hours for international arrivals, as you will need to clear immigration and customs before proceeding to the Federal Air departure lounge.\n\nBaggage restrictions on these smaller shuttle aircraft are strictly enforced. Passengers are typically limited to 20kg (44 lbs) per person in a soft-sided bag. Excess luggage can be stored securely at Federal Air's facility at O.R. Tambo for a nominal fee. This is a critical point to consider when packing, as large, hard-shell suitcases may not be accepted on the flight.\n\nTransfers between MalaMala and other nearby private airstrips or the larger Skukuza Airport (SZK) can also be arranged via private air or road charter, but these must be booked well in advance through the reserve's reservations department. If you miss your scheduled shuttle flight, your options are extremely limited, and the only alternative is a lengthy and expensive private road transfer. Communication with both your international airline and the MalaMala reservations team is key to ensuring a smooth and stress-free connection.
